Output 4fab23ad8105d0e2743a2ed2a8a7914d31f654151dcdb789f495de99b8142847:0

value
102299566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48da2d45ce887e65381cad16caf405d70e398405 OP_EQUALVERIFY OP_CHECKSIG
address
17eD21HGuUAP1NhmEyyMTJ1DVThToH4zDk
transaction
4fab23ad8105d0e2743a2ed2a8a7914d31f654151dcdb789f495de99b8142847
spent
true